Job Purpose

Develop and implement the ENEC and UAE nuclear research and development program and establish strategic R&D relationships with domestic and international research partners to support UAE national strategy for advanced innovation.

Activity:Nuclear Research Program Development
Responsibility:
•Prepare and implement the appropriate strategies and systems to ensure effective coordination, monitoring and evaluation of research work.
•Develop and guide business plans and business cases to ensure availability of funds for research purposes.

Collaboration and Partnership within R&D program
Responsibility:
•Provide support in promoting ENEC and the UAE Nuclear Program to establish strategic R&D relationships with research partners.
•Provide support in establishing a framework to enable collaborations and partnerships with leading international research and development institutions and programs.
•Provide support in establishing contractual agreements with research and development entities to maximize intellectual property for the UAE.
•Conduct research and development benchmarking with international programs to identify best practices and opportunities.

Scholarships and Training
Responsibility: In collaborate with Scholarship, Career Development and CPT teams:
•Provide support in aligning Scholarships with the R&D needs of the Barakah Nuclear Power Plant in order to build subject matter expertise capabilities.
•Provide support in developing and implementing R&D competency development framework, and training and secondment programs for ENEC enterprise employees in order to develop research and development subject matter expertise in the organization.
